Biblical counselling is different from other forms of counselling in that it uses the Bible for its authority. Our counselors will help you understand your problems using the Bible and then help you apply real solutions that will bring lasting change to your life. We believe the Bible can help real people with their real problems. 

What should I expect?

There are three things that we expect from those who come for counseling:

  1. Commitment to Honesty - It is very important that every person who comes for counseling be open and honest. Finding solutions and answers to life's problems require first accurately understanding the problems. 
  2. Commitment to Homework - At the conclusion of every counseling session you will receive specific homework from your counsellor. It is very important that you take this homework seriously and make every effort to complete it. Homework is not an add on to the counseling process but an integral part of it. 
  3. Commitment to Time - Lastly you should expect counselling to take some time. Life's problems are often complicated and it will require time to break old habits and form new ones.
